Как устроены базы данных и зачем они нужны
Как устроены базы данных и зачем они нужны
Базы данных составляют собой систематизированные архивы сведений, которые эксплуатируются практически во всех современных цифровых комплексах. Каждый день множества людей соприкасаются с базами данных, даже не осознавая об этом. Когда пользователь запускает социальную сеть, делает приобретение в интернет-магазине или сверяет состояние карты, за кулисами работают комплексные структуры контроля информацией.
Первостепенная функция базы данных заключается в упорядочении и размещении больших количеств информации. Информация располагаются в специальных схемах, которые помогают быстро обнаруживать нужные информацию. пинап осуществляет не только содержание, но и продуктивную переработку информации.
Современные базы данных сформированы по схеме схем, где информация распределяется по записям и колонкам. Специальные приложения управляют обращением к данным и отслеживают за непротиворечивостью информации. пинап казино позволяет составлять сложные запросы для выборки требуемой данных за доли секунды.
Что такое база данных и её главное функция
База данных — это систематизированная собрание сведений, подготовленная для простого содержания, извлечения и анализа. Такие системы включают систематизированные данные о клиентах, продуктах, платежах и других объектах. Информация находится в упорядоченном виде, что обеспечивает быстро получать обращение к нужным записям.
Главное функция базы данных состоит в консолидированном управлении сведениями. Вместо сохранения сведений в обособленных массивах предприятия применяют централизованное хранилище. pin up ускоряет деятельность с данными и предотвращает копирование строк.
Базы данных реализуют задачу коллективного обращения к сведениям. Несколько сотрудников могут совместно взаимодействовать с идентичными и теми же информацией без конфликтов. пинап гарантирует единообразие сведений даже при интенсивной работе.
Нынешние базы данных гарантируют устойчивость содержания жизненно существенной сведений. Механизмы дублирующего сохранения защищают информацию от исчезновения при отказах оборудования.
Организация данных в систематизированном формате
Систематизация сведений составляет собой основополагающий принцип работы баз данных. Сведения распределяются по таблицам, где каждая запись содержит индивидуальную данные, а поля устанавливают параметры единиц. Такая организация обеспечивает систематически группировать однотипную данные.
Каждая матрица в базе данных имеет строгую организацию с установленными столбцами. Поле является собой самостоятельный характеристику строки, например наименование покупателя или цену продукта. Предоставляет стандартизацию сохранения данных и оптимизирует её переработку.
Систематизированная схема информации содержит несколько существенных компонентов:
- Основные ключи для единственной определения записей
- Типы информации для проверки формата данных
- Индексы для повышения скорости извлечения по таблицам
- Ограничения целостности для предотвращения ошибок
Грамотная структура базы данных устраняет избыточность сведений. Снижает массив хранимых информации и ускоряет актуализацию. Упорядочение таблиц ликвидирует размножение.
Сохранение крупных количеств данных и стремительный обращение к ним
Актуальные базы данных способны содержать терабайты и петабайты сведений. Крупные компании аккумулируют миллиарды элементов о пользователях и платежах. пинап повышает использование жёсткого ресурса и рабочей ресурса.
Скорость доступа к информации продолжает быть жизненно ключевым характеристикой действия баз данных. Клиенты рассчитывают на немедленных результатов на обращения даже при выполнении миллионов элементов. Индексирование схем помогает обнаруживать искомые данные за доли секунды.
Буферизация постоянно используемых данных улучшает функционирование программ. База данных удерживает востребованные команды в быстрой ресурсе для немедленного обращения. Сокращает нагрузку на жёсткую часть и усиливает производительность структуры.
Децентрализованные базы данных размещают данные на нескольких хостах. Такая организация предоставляет параллельное расширение и управление увеличивающихся количеств информации.
Связи между информацией и структура их структурирования
Связи между схемами составляют базис табличных баз данных. Отличающиеся типы данных связываются через особые главные параметры, выстраивая целостную структуру. pin up обеспечивает системную непротиворечивость и непротиворечивость полной системы.
Вторичные ключи определяют отношения между схемами. Поле в одной схеме указывает на главный ключ другой матрицы, формируя отношение между элементами. Такая организация помогает сохранять сведения о покупателях изолированно от данных о запросах.
Базы данных предоставляют несколько вариантов взаимосвязей между схемами:
- Один к одному — каждая строка ассоциирована с уникальной элементом
- Один ко многим — одна запись соединена с разными строками
- Многие ко многим — многочисленные строки привязаны между собой
Упорядочение сведений предотвращает дублирование и совершенствует структуру базы. Распределяет данные на смысловые группы и формирует верные взаимосвязи. Механизм стандартизации увеличивает продуктивность сохранения информации.
Применение баз данных в повседневных сервисах
Базы данных работают в незаметном режиме почти каждого компьютерного службы. Социальные сети хранят аккаунты пользователей, снимки и записи в огромных базах данных. Каждое действие — размещение материала или реплика — записывается в систему и делается открытым для прочих клиентов.
Интернет-магазины эксплуатируют базы данных для администрирования ассортиментом товаров и переработки заказов. пинап казино даёт возможность немедленно корректировать данные о присутствии продукции и показывать текущие стоимости. Платформы предложений обрабатывают хронологию приобретений и советуют позиции на основе предпочтений.
Банковские программы осуществляют миллионы операций ежедневно. База данных регистрирует каждый перевод и операцию с скрупулёзностью до копейки. Подтверждает сохранность экономической данных и исключает незаконный проникновение.
Навигационные сервисы содержат атласы и сведения о пробках в выделенных базах. Платформы бронирования регулируют свободностью билетов и выполняют заказы в формате актуального времени.
Надёжность и защита информации в базах данных
Обеспечение информации представляет собой главную цель каждой комплекса контроля базами. Конфиденциальная данные пользователей и денежные строки требуют устойчивой охраны от неавторизованного проникновения. Многослойная комплекс безопасности контролирует каждое взаимодействие к сведениям.
Авторизация участников подтверждает идентичность каждого, кто взаимодействует к базе данных. Системы ожидают ввода имени и шифра, а также могут эксплуатировать двухфакторную аутентификацию. пинап дифференцирует полномочия обращения для различных категорий клиентов.
Шифрование информации защищает информацию при размещении и транспортировке по каналу. База данных переводит понятный данные в зашифрованный код, который нельзя понять без выделенного ключа. Предоставляет конфиденциальность даже при материальном подключении к хостам.
Журналирование действий записывает все активности пользователей в базе данных. Механизм регистрирует время взаимодействия и исполненные запросы. Проверка обеспечивает обнаружить подозрительную действия.
Изменение и согласование информации в актуальном времени
Актуальные базы данных обрабатывают модификации сведений моментально. Когда пользователь актуализирует профиль или делает заказ, платформа оперативно регистрирует обновлённые данные. пин ап казино вход обеспечивает достоверность сведений для всех пользователей синхронно.
Синхронизация данных между несколькими узлами гарантирует непротиворечивость распределённых структур. Модификации, сделанные на одном сервере, автоматически переносятся на прочие узлы. pin up исключает несоответствия в информации и осуществляет унификацию информации.
Столкновения при одновременном корректировке аналогичных и тех же записей устраняются специализированными механизмами. База данных резервирует записи на момент актуализации или использует оптимистичную методику проверки. Комплекс контролирует варианты сведений и предотвращает пропажу модификаций.
Тиражирование данных формирует дубликаты базы на географически размещённых узлах. Участники обретают подключение к соседнему узлу, что сокращает паузы. Повышает устойчивость комплекса при авариях устройств.
Архивное архивирование и реконструкция данных
Архивное сохранение предохраняет базы данных от пропажи чрезвычайно существенной сведений. Комплексы автоматически генерируют экземпляры сведений через назначенные отрезки времени. Резервные экземпляры размещаются на независимых носителях или отдалённых серверах.
Тотальное архивирование генерирует слепок совокупной базы данных в конкретный период времени. Такие копии дают возможность регенерировать структуру абсолютно. Реализует полное копирование понедельно или помесячно в отношении от объёма информации.
Добавочное сохранение фиксирует только изменения, возникшие с момента последней запасной реплики. Такой способ сберегает ресурс на устройствах и повышает механизм. Совмещает полное и инкрементное архивирование для оптимального компромисса.
Регенерация сведений переводит базу в активное положение после сбоев или погрешностей. Администраторы определяют подходящую резервную реплику и инициируют операцию восстановления. пинап казино снижает длительность бездействия и утрату сведений при аварийных обстоятельствах.
Место баз данных в действии актуальных приложений и порталов
Базы данных формируют ядро произвольного актуального веб-приложения или мобильного платформы. Без структур контроля данными невозможна функционирование интернет-платформ, которыми задействуют миллиарды людей постоянно. Каждый нажатие или шаг пользователя соприкасается с базой данных.
Динамический материал порталов генерируется на базе сведений из баз данных. Новостные ресурсы получают материалы, обсуждения подгружают комментарии, а видеоплатформы выбирают сведения клипов. Это даёт возможность формировать персонализированный наполнение для каждого клиента.
Карманные программы согласовывают информацию с удалёнными базами для обеспечения доступа с разных гаджетов. Клиент открывает деятельность на смартфоне и ведёт на планшете без утраты продвижения. pin up предоставляет непрерывный опыт использования на множестве сред.
Аналитические механизмы анализируют информацию из баз для выработки деловых заключений. Компании обрабатывают действия пользователей и предвидят потребность. пинап казино преобразует необработанные информацию в значимые выводы для развития продуктов.
